1: package body ECX_INBOUND_ENGINE_QH as
2: -- $Header: ECXIEQHB.pls 120.4.12010000.2 2010/02/24 14:32:59 alsosa ship $
3: ------------------------------------------------------------------------------+
4: PROCEDURE Dequeue(p_agent_guid in RAW, p_event out nocopy WF_EVENT_T)
5: is
6: x_queue_name varchar2(80);
7: x_agent_name varchar2(30);
8: x_msgid RAW(16);
54: end if;
55:
56: v_dequeueoptions.wait := 1;
57:
58: wf_event_t.initialize(p_event);
59: wf_event_t.initialize(ecx_utils.g_event);
60: p_event.event_name := 'oracle.apps.ecx.inbound.message.process';
61:
62: savepoint before_dequeue;
55:
56: v_dequeueoptions.wait := 1;
57:
58: wf_event_t.initialize(p_event);
59: wf_event_t.initialize(ecx_utils.g_event);
60: p_event.event_name := 'oracle.apps.ecx.inbound.message.process';
61:
62: savepoint before_dequeue;
63: v_log_enabled_appl := fnd_profile.value_specific(name=>'AFLOG_ENABLED',
133: raise;
134: end Dequeue;
135:
136:
137: PROCEDURE enqueue(p_event in wf_event_t,
138: p_out_agent_override in wf_agent_t )
139: is
140: x_out_agent_name varchar2(30);
141: x_out_system_name varchar2(30);